US National Security Adviser H.R. McMaster has repeatedly mocked President Donald Trump’s intellect, according to a report.

McMaster allegedly called Trump as an “idiot” and a “dope” who has the intelligence of a “kindergartner”, according to a report published by BuzzFeed News on Tuesday.

The report indicated the comments were allegedly made during a dinner in July with Oracle CEO Safra Catz. The media outlet claimed five separate sources had knowledge of the conversation, four of whom said they heard of the exchange directly from Catz.

“[Catz] said the conversation was so inappropriate that it was jaw-dropping,” one source told BuzzFeed News.

McMaster also allegedly made comments about Trump’s son-in-law and senior adviser, Jared Kushner. He reportedly said Kushner had no business being in the White House and failed to understand national security issues.

Both Oracle and the Trump administration have denied the comments were made.

“Actual participants in the dinner deny that General McMaster made any of the comments attributed to him by anonymous sources. Those false comments represent the diametric opposite of General McMaster’s actual views,” Michael Anton, a spokesman for the National Security Council, told BuzzFeed News.
